When the clients approached for my expertise, they had no design system or formal brand guidelines for their application. After several consultations with them using design explorations and style guides, we finalized on the following updates:

  • San serif fonts with more personality for the headers

  • Blue color theme to evoke a sense of trust and reliability

  • Modern design and feel

The original logo was not responsive, had inconsistent spacing, and gradients that didn’t consider other potential backgrounds other than white.

With the updated version of the logo, I simplified it while keeping the key elements such as the crown. I made necessary adjustments to the spacing within the crown and added sufficient space inside the logo. I kerned the wordmark as well.

If I could go back in⏱️time, what would I do differently?

Knowing what I know now, I would’ve gone the extra mile to create a more detailed information architecture map with specific examples from existing applications — outside what was made in reference to the statement of work that was provided. I learned that for many partners I work with, they share the common pain-point of interpreting UX flows and understanding why certain methodologies are industry-standard. With providing real examples and explainations paired with a map that’s in parallel to their application, this can help bridge the knowledge gap.
